Amendment of regulation 51 of the General Regulations
22. In regulation 51 of the General Regulations (notional capital)—
(a)in paragraph (2) for the words “it would be so acquired” there shall be substituted the words “it could be expected to be acquired were an application made”;
(b)in paragraph (3)—
(i)at the beginning for the words “Any payment of capital” there shall be substituted the words “Any payment of capital, other than a payment of capital made under the Macfarlane Trust,”;
(ii)in sub-paragraph (a)(ii) after the words “17(e) or 18(f) (housing costs)” there shall be inserted the words “or accommodation charge to the extent that it is met under regulation 19 or 20 (persons in residential care or nursing homes or in board and lodging accommodation or hostels);”;
(c)after paragraph (6) there shall be added the following paragraph—
“(7) For the avoidance of doubt a claimant is to be treated as possessing capital under paragraph (1) only if the capital of which he has deprived himself is actual capital.”.
